Analysis and diagnosis

From signal to commercial meaning.

B2B teams often act on ARR, churn, renewal and account-health signals before source-system issues are visible. RenewalOS shows a synthetic analytics workflow where data exceptions, reconciliation gaps and decision rules are exposed before Customer Success prioritization is reviewed.

Decision layer

Recommended business action

Recommendations follow the evidence in this independent case study; no tested uplift is implied.
  1. 01

    Review quality exceptions before treating ARR, churn or renewal metrics as management KPIs

  2. 02

    Use reconciliation gaps as blockers that require evidence rather than manual smoothing

  3. 03

    Treat CSM prioritization output as simulated scenario planning until validated on real data

  4. 04

    Keep excluded records visible so capacity decisions do not hide data-trust issues

04

Method and quality

How the conclusion was built.

The technical record stays inspectable without displacing the business question.

Methodology

  1. 01

    Generated synthetic source data for contracts, billing, usage, support and Customer Success activity

  2. 02

    Loaded untrusted records into DuckDB and modeled warehouse layers with dbt

  3. 03

    Applied data-quality controls and revenue reconciliation checks before KPI reporting

  4. 04

    Built explainable account-health diagnostics with source exceptions still visible

  5. 05

    Produced capacity-constrained CSM prioritization scenarios with explicit exclusions

Architecture

  1. 01

    Synthetic source domains feed a local DuckDB warehouse modeled with dbt.

  2. 02

    Quality controls and revenue reconciliation checks surface source-data exceptions before KPI-facing views are used.

  3. 03

    Account-health diagnostics explain risk signals while preserving blocked or excluded records.

  4. 04

    OR-Tools applies simulated CSM capacity limits to scenario recommendations, not production decisions.

Material limitations

  • Uses synthetic data only.
  • Outputs are diagnostic and are not trusted management KPI reporting.
  • CSM prioritization is simulated scenario analysis, not observed intervention evidence.
  • No observed business impact, customer outcome or model-accuracy claim is made.
  • No production deployment is configured or claimed.
